Places in Texas Where You Can See Bighorn Sheep

Bighorn sheep are iconic symbols of the American West. Did you know Texas is home to 11 herds of them? Though Texas’s desert bighorn sheep differ slightly from Rocky Mountain bighorn sheep, such as those you can find in Hells Canyon, they’re worth seeing for yourself. Keep reading to learn about some places in Texas where you can see bighorn sheep.

Big Bend National Park

Located in western Texas along the Rio Grande, Big Bend National Park is home to beautiful scenic views and a thriving population of desert bighorn sheep. Visitors often spot bighorn sheep grazing on the rugged cliffs alongside the park’s hiking trails.

Guadalupe Mountains National Park

Texas’s other national park, Guadalupe Mountains National Park, is also home to bighorn sheep. Located in the Chihuahuan Desert in western Texas, the park’s rocky terrain provides an ideal habitat for these animals. Hiking through the park can offer a chance to see the sheep for yourself.

Black Gap Wildlife Management Area

The Black Gap Wildlife Management Area is another park on the Rio Grande that offers excellent opportunities to spot desert bighorn sheep. By visiting Black Gap, you’ll be able to see bighorn sheep in their natural habitat.

The Sierra Diablo

The Sierra Diablo mountain range is known for its scenic beauty and diverse wildlife. The mountains’ rocky slopes provide the perfect habitat for bighorn sheep. Hike or take a vehicle up the mountains for a chance to spot some sheep.
